Parkes: Evatt will learn from axe

16 February 2009 16:44
The towering centre-back, 27, was dropped after the Seasiders' 3-2 home defeat to Doncaster in their previous outing before the trip to Suffolk.[LNB]Parkes' decision looked justified as Blackpool ground out a creditable point at Portman Road but the caretaker boss is backing Evatt to respond in a positive manner.[LNB]"It is important Ian reacts in the right way," said Parkes.[LNB]"He should be disappointed but he has to show it in a professional way, like everybody else does.[LNB]"But Ian will get over his disappointment and will hopefully come back a better centre-half."[LNB][LNB]
